iOS:如果我将 UILabel 添加到 UIView,视图是不是具有标签的固有内容大小?

Posted

技术标签:

【中文标题】iOS:如果我将 UILabel 添加到 UIView,视图是不是具有标签的固有内容大小?【英文标题】:iOS: if I add UILabel to a UIView, will the view has intrinsic content size of the label?iOS:如果我将 UILabel 添加到 UIView,视图是否具有标签的固有内容大小? 【发布时间】:2015-01-15 03:35:04 【问题描述】:

正如标题所述,我需要在容器视图中有几个标签,比如标签一个接一个水平对齐,容器视图是否具有正确的内在内容大小,或者我必须继承 UIView 并手动计算吗?

【问题讨论】:

【参考方案1】:

不,但如果你使用自动布局,这可以在没有子类化的情况下实现(我的意思是它会正确调整大小,我认为它不会为你计算内在大小)

【讨论】:

以上是关于iOS:如果我将 UILabel 添加到 UIView,视图是不是具有标签的固有内容大小?的主要内容,如果未能解决你的问题,请参考以下文章

ios:如何在背景图像上添加 uiLabel?

无法在 IOS 6 中将 UILabel 添加到 UITableViewCell

iOS - 创建自定义 UILabel 并将它们添加到 UIView

UIPickerView 自定义视图奇怪的行为

adjustsFontSizeToFitWidth 时 UILabel 的裁剪

如何使用 Objective-C 将字符添加到 iOS 中的 UILabel 动画?